Output d8dbbbf7bca6e4415fc84ad8ce4e117283f13991c84be52c8c3a7311ed7d7694:2

value
500515
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fb5a1950b6963841400105d295750d0d668a83e1 OP_EQUAL
address
3Qc3TsdG3yvDEDop4e3LY44hvDMwyMQKct
transaction
d8dbbbf7bca6e4415fc84ad8ce4e117283f13991c84be52c8c3a7311ed7d7694
spent
true